JavaScript封装的SQLite操作类实例
在前端开发中,我们经常需要对本地数据进行存储和操作。而SQLite是一种轻量级关系型数据库管理系统,它提供了一些强大的功能,例如事务处理、数据类型支持等等。在JavaScript中,我们可以通过封装SQLite操作类来简化对SQLite数据库的访问。
SQLite基础知识
SQLite是一个文件型的数据库,它是C语言编写的,可以跨平台使用。在SQLite中,表由多个列组成,每个列都有一个数据类型,例如INTEGER、TEXT、REAL等等。SQLite支持的数据类型较为简单,但足以满足大部分应用场景。
封装SQLite操作类
下面我们将介绍如何使用JavaScript封装SQLite操作类。
安装依赖
我们需要安装node-sqlite3依赖,这是一个Node.js与SQLite交互的驱动包。
--- ------- ------- ------
创建SQLite操作类
我们可以创建一个SQLite类来封装SQLite数据库的操作。这个类需要实现以下功能:
- 打开数据库连接。
- 关闭数据库连接。
- 执行SQL语句。
- 获取查询结果。
以下是SQLite类的示例代码:
----- ------- - ---------------------------- ----- ------ - ------------------- - ------- - --- ------------------------ - ------ - ------ --- ----------------- ------- -- - -------------------- -- - --------- -- -- - ------- - ------ --- ----------------- ------- -- - ------------------- -- - -- ----- - ----------- - ---- - --------- - -- -- - -------- ------ - --- - ------ --- ----------------- ------- -- - ---------------- ------- ------------- - -- ----- - ----------- - ---- - --------- --- ------------ -------- ------------ -- - -- -- - -------- ------ - --- - ------ --- ----------------- ------- -- - ---------------- ------- ------------- ----- - -- ----- - ----------- - ---- - ------------- - -- -- - -
使用SQLite操作类
我们可以使用SQLite类来执行SQL语句,例如创建表、插入数据、查询数据等。以下是一个示例:
----- -- - --- ----------------- ----- -------- ------ - ----- --------- -- --- ----- -------------- - - ------ ----- -- --- ------ ----- - -- ------- ------- ---- ---- ----- --- ------- - - ----- ---------------------- -- ---- ----- --------- - ------- ---- ----------- ---- --------- --- ----- ----------------- ------ ---- -- ---- ----- --------- - ------- - ---- ----- ----- --- - -- ----- ---- - ----- ----------------- ----- ----------------- ----- ---------- - ------
总结
通过封装SQLite操作类,我们可以轻松地对SQLite数据库进行访问。在实际开发中,我们可以使用这个类来存储和操作本地数据,提高应用程序的性能和用户体验。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/3503